Points forts
- Intel Atom® E3845/Celeron® J1900 Processors
- One 204-pin DDR3L SODIMM socket supports up to 8GB DDR3L 1333 SDRAM
- 3 USB, 1 LAN, 1 COM
- Wide voltage +12V ~ +26V input, ErP power
- Full system IP65
Description du produit
The Avalue SPC-1709 is a 17" industrial touch panel PC featuring an Intel® Atom™ Processor E3845 or Celeron® J1900. It includes a fanless design, 5-wire resistive touch screen, dual Gigabit LAN, multiple USB and COM ports, and HDMI support.
The panel is IP65 rated, suitable for rugged environments, supports wide voltage input, and operates within a temperature range from -20°C to 60°C.
